Divorce is the dissolution of a marriage by a judge's decision or the demands of one of the parties to the marriage. It is the same as leaving another party without permission and a valid reason or other things beyond one's capabilities. Things that can cause divorce can vary, from incompatibility, domestic violence, to infidelity. The problem in this research is the factors causing the Plaintiff to file a lawsuit for Divorce Based on Decision Number 83/Pdt.G/2024/PN.TJK. and the judge's consideration in granting the divorce suit was because the wife ran away based on Decision Number 83/Pdt.G/2024/PN.Tjk. The research method used in this thesis research is a normative juridical approach and an empirical approach. Secondary data is data obtained through literature studies (library research) such as literature books and scientific works related to research problems. Secondary data consists of 3 (three) legal materials, namely, primary, secondary and tertiary legal materials. Prime data is data obtained from research results in the field directly on the research object (field research) which is carried out by direct observation and interviews regarding the object in writing this thesis. Furthermore, the Judge's consideration in granting the divorce was based on the fact that the wife had abandoned the marriage, as stipulated in Decision Number 83/Pdt.G/2024/PN.Tjk, in accordance with Article 39 of Law Number 1 of 1974, as amended by Law Number 16 of 2019 on Marriage, which states in conjunction with Article 19(f) of Government Regulation Number 9 of 1975 concerning the implementation of Law Number 1 of 1974 on Marriage, that divorce may occur due to reasons including continuous disputes and conflicts between husband and wife, with no hope of reconciliation in the household.
